Lincoln Middle School is a public middle school in Oakland, OR, serving grades 5–8, rated C+, with 191 students and a 17.4:1 student-teacher ratio.

In 2024-2025, the share of students meeting the state standard was 46% in English Language Arts, 27% in Math and 23% in Science.
